Job description

Are you passionate about delivering excellent customer service and helping young people take the next step in their educational journey?

City College Norwich is seeking an enthusiastic, organised and proactive Admissions and School Liaison Coordinator to play a key role in supporting prospective students from their first enquiry through to enrolment. This is an exciting opportunity for a customer-focused professional who enjoys building relationships, managing processes and contributing to student recruitment success.

About the Role

As an Admissions and School Liaison Coordinator, you will coordinate admissions activities and support school engagement initiatives across the College. Working closely with prospective students, parents/carers, partner schools and internal colleagues, you will ensure a seamless and positive experience throughout the recruitment and admissions cycle.

You will be responsible for managing applications, interviews, offers and enrolment processes while maintaining accurate student records and admissions data. The role also involves supporting recruitment events, school visits, presentations and engagement activities that encourage applications and support enrolment targets.

As an ambassador for City College Norwich, you will develop strong relationships with schools, careers professionals and other external stakeholders, helping to promote the wide range of opportunities available to our students.

As a College we are required to undertake various Safer Recruitment checks as set out within the guidance from the Department for Education Keeping Child Safe in Education.We require all staff to undertake an enhanced Adult and Child Workforce DBS Check and to register with the DBS Update Service. From 28 November 2020, changes were made to the DBS filtering rules. As DBS certificates issued before this date may have been produced under different filtering arrangements, we are unable to rely on an Update Service status check for certificates issued before 28 November 2020. In these circumstances, a new DBS application will be required.
